Homer, Odyssey 15.401-2

“In time, a man takes pleasure even in pain, when he has suffered so much and wandered so far.”

 

…μετὰ γάρ τε καὶ ἄλγεσι τέρπεται ἀνήρ,

ὅς τις δὴ μάλα πολλὰ πάθῃ καὶ πόλλ’ ἐπαληθῇ.
